A MAN suffered a serious head injury after being knocked to the ground in a fight outside a pub.
The victim, who is aged in his 40s, was attacked and seriously injured outside the Jolly Friar Pub, in Whitmore Way, Basildon on Tuesday night at about 11.30pm.
Police say the victim was involved in an altercation with a group of men.
One of the men punched the victim, who became unconscious and fell to the ground, hitting his head. The group then ran off.
The man was taken to hospital and remains in a serious but stable condition.
A large cordon was in place around the pub at the front and side of the building, with police cars, officers and a forensic officer on scene.
